I use this web site in my elementary libraries.  It is so awesome.  You can
choose from many books including Harry Potter and give the students story
word problems based on books.  It is divided by grade level.  I use it for
collaboration purposes, it really helps student get ready for those state
math test.  They also read the books if you tell them in head of time which
book will be used the next library time.

http://www.mathstories.com
